Genus Peristylus

View Botanical Profile & Insights

Classified within the Orchidaceae family, the genus Peristylus is a group comprising 104 taxa. It is widespread across Tropical Asia, and is also natively found in Temperate Asia, Australasia, and the Pacific. Across its taxa, it is commonly associated with wet tropical, seasonally dry tropical, and subtropical climate conditions. It is composed entirely of herbaceous perennials.

Data Profile

  • Taxonomic Scale: 104 taxa (102 base species, 2 variants).
  • Centers of Diversity: Tropical Asia (85), Temperate Asia (18), the Pacific (14)
  • Primary Climates: Wet Tropical (66), Seasonally Dry Tropical (18), Subtropical (16)
  • Dominant Forms: Herbaceous Perennials (104)
